About Viget

Viget focuses on designing and engineering digital products and experiences that engage customers and help businesses grow. Their team consists of designers, engineers, and strategists who work collaboratively to create tailored solutions for their clients. Viget stands out from competitors by prioritizing diversity and inclusion within their workforce, which allows them to better understand and meet the varied needs of their clients. The company's goal is to enhance the digital landscape by fostering an inclusive environment and delivering impactful digital solutions.

Benefits

We offer competitive salaries, annual raises, and a 401(k) plan matched up to 4%
We cover 100% of your health & dental insurance (and your family’s, too)
We offer healthy snacks in each office and foster a culture of well-being with initiatives
We champion sustainable workweeks balanced with 9 paid holidays, 15 days PTO (20 after 2 years), and 2 community service days
We outfit our team with 27 in displays and your choice of Macbook Air or Pro. In most cases, you can select the software you prefer
We provide an annual conference stipend, internal micro-classes, and opportunities to explore new tech on self-directed projects
